                              It's all back together, and I drove it. OATOA engine feels happy. 

                              Only 15 miles in, but so far things are good. I'm running with engine break-in oil, keeping RPM varied <4k and throttle input <60%. Plan is to keep putting around in it like that, change the oil after 50 miles for another batch of break-in oil, and then change that batch of oil out at around 500 miles.
